Hitting The Gaming Motherlode: Cerise Magazine
Cerise Magazine is an online monthly magazine by and for women gamers. ‘Nuff said, but I’ll expound.
From their Mission Statement: "Our features include industry news, profiles of gender-inclusive game modules, spotlights of game developers and prominent voices in gamer communities, game reviews, art, and editorials." Cerise Magazine is part of the Iris Gaming Network, whose goal is to "bring women’s perspectives into the mainstream".
According to the Cerise Magazine archive, there are at least 16 issues for you to read, so get busy! While I couldn’t find anything on my game of choice, EVE Online, there’s plenty about WoW, Final Fantasy and D&D, which are now pretty much the classics.
